Capitel Foscarino is one of the wines that Anselmi produces from a single vineyard. In these regions, the designation Capitel refers to a single vineyard. This may only be used for wines originating from the specific slope. Capitel Foscarino is a south-facing vineyard, 350 meters above sea level, with a calcareous, volcanic subsoil that quickly drains any rainwater. The vineyard covers 10 hectares and produces approximately 45 hectoliters per hectare. The selection of the harvest at Foscarino is strict and therefore takes place twice. The grapes used for this wine are always very ripe, resulting in a wine of power and richness. During vinification, cold maceration of the must takes place; after pneumatic pressing, the juice is fermented at a controlled temperature of 16°C. After this process, the wine spends 6 months in stainless steel tanks with natural yeast cells and undergoes bâtonnage. The wine then ages in the bottle for the final 6 months. The wines have an aging potential of ten years.

In the glass, the Anselmi Capitel Foscarino has a seductive golden yellow color. The Anselmi Capitel Foscarino is golden yellow in the glass. This rich Soave from a distinct cru has aromas of honey, apricot, and peach on the nose, with a rich and powerful, exotic and full palate, and a touch of bitterness in the long and complex finish. A very handsome Soave made from aged Garganega.

Roberto Anselmi is one of those who strictly adheres to the ground rules. In fact, he's one of the producers who promotes others to do the same. Anselmi sees it as the importance of the region (Veneto, Northern Italy) that the overall quality of the wines improves. Not an easy mission. Where others have given way to the planting of the worldwide so popular chardonnay, Anselmi limits itself to a modest five percent.

Anselmi is also one of the few to have more vines in its vineyards than officially prescribed: 5000 to 7000 per hectare. The much lower yield per stick as a result yields wines that are fuller and more powerful in character. In addition, all his poles are on the better slopes, so in the Classico region. The quality of the wines starts in the vineyards, Anselmi knows better than anyone. Quality is therefore what makes Roberto Anselmi. A great winemaker who practices his profession with fanaticism.
